Ingredients
Scale
Main Ingredients:
- 1 1/2 cups pecan halves
- 1 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ips
- 3 large eggs
- 3/4 cup light corn syrup
- 1 cup granulated sugar
- 1/2 cup brown sugar, packed
Baking Base:
- 1 unbaked 9-inch pie crust
Flavor Enhancers:
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
Instructions
- Position the oven rack in the center and preheat to 350°F. Gently transfer the pie crust into a 9-inch pie pan, carefully crimping the edges for a polished appearance.
- Create a smooth chocolate base by microwaving chocolate chips and butter in 30-second bursts, stirring between intervals until completely melted and glossy. Allow the mixture to cool slightly.
- In a separate mixing bowl, thoroughly whisk together granulated sugar, brown sugar, eggs, vanilla extract, salt, and light corn syrup until the ingredients are fully integrated and smooth.
- Pour the melted chocolate mixture into the sugar mixture, stirring continuously to create a uniform, rich filling. Gently fold in pecan halves, distributing them evenly throughout.
- Transfer the filling into the prepared pie crust, using a spatula to ensure an even distribution and smooth surface.
- Place the pie in the preheated oven and bake for 50-55 minutes. The pie is ready when the center appears set and the top develops a subtle crackled texture.
- Remove from the oven and allow the pie to cool completely at room temperature. For an indulgent presentation, serve with a dollop of whipped cream or a scoop of vanilla ice cream.
Notes
- Toast pecans before adding to enhance their nutty flavor and provide extra crunch.
- Prevent pie crust edges from burning by covering with aluminum foil during last 15-20 minutes of baking.
- Use high-quality dark chocolate for richer, more intense chocolate flavor in the filling.
- For gluten-free version, substitute traditional pie crust with almond flour or gluten-free pastry crust.
